A refinery manufactures two grades of fuel, F1 and F2, by blending four types gasoline, A, B, C, D. Fuel F1 uses gasolines A, B, C, and Din the ratio 1:1:2:4, uel F2 uses the ratio 2:2:1:3. The supply limits for A, B, C, and Dare 1000, 120 00, and 1500 bbl/day respectively. The costs per bbl for gasolines A, B, C, an , are $120, $90, $100, and $150, respectively. Fuels F1 and F2 sell for $200 an 250 per bbl, respectively. The minimum demand for F1 and F2 is 200 and 400 bl/day, respectively. Develop an LP model and determine the optimal roduction mix for F1 and F2.
